Formatowanie w kolumnach
Thread - 20-11-2006 01:02
Formatowanie w kolumnach
Witam. Im problem prostrzy tym chyba bardziej nurtujący ;) Piszę maleński programik do konwersji liczb/tekstu na różne systemy liczbowe - kodASCI (dziesiętny, szesnastkowy, itp)
To tylko kawałek przykłaku: Na wejściu podaję "ałóąś", jako wynik: a 61 97 ł 142 322 ó f3 243 ą 105 261 ś 15b 347
Samo zamienianie jest banale String napis = "ałóąś" robie to w pętli // na szesnastkowy Integer.toHexString( (int)napis.charAt(i) ) // na dzieciętny (int)napis.charAt(i)
Niestety mam problem wyświetlenie tego w kolumnach, tak jak pokazałem wyżej. Do liczb rzeczywistych bez problemu można zastosować DecimalFormat. A jak tutaj to zrobić? :/
Pozdrawiam, Thread -- ..:: Thread ..:: Andrzej Kłopotowski ..:: thread{at}o2{dot}pl
Brzezi - 20-11-2006 01:02
sob, 02 wrz 2006 o 10:36 GMT, Thread napisał(a):
> Niestety mam problem wyświetlenie tego w kolumnach, tak jak pokazałem wyżej.
to jeszcze napisz co jest tym problemem...
> Do liczb rzeczywistych bez problemu można zastosować DecimalFormat. > A jak tutaj to zrobić? :/
sa inne formatery
Pozdrawiam Brzezi -- [ E-mail: brzezi@enter.net.pl ][ ] [ Ekg: #3781111 ][ ] [ LinuxUser: #249916 ][ ]
Thread - 20-11-2006 01:02
Brzezi wrote:
> sob, 02 wrz 2006 o 10:36 GMT, Thread napisał(a): > >> Niestety mam problem wyświetlenie tego w kolumnach, tak jak pokazałem >> wyżej. > > to jeszcze napisz co jest tym problemem... Ok, może się niezbyć jasno wyraziłem. Chodzi mi o wyświetlenie tych wartości np. w trzech kolumnach, przy czym, żeby prawe strony poszczególnych kolumn były w równe, czyli, żeby przed każdą z tych liczb dodawać odpowiednią liczbę spacji. Programik konsolowy.
> >> Do liczb rzeczywistych bez problemu można zastosować DecimalFormat. >> A jak tutaj to zrobić? :/ > > sa inne formatery No właśnie, tylko chodzi o to aby wstrzelić się w ten właściwy;)
> > Pozdrawiam > Brzezi
Pozdrawiam, Thread -- ..:: Thread ..:: Andrzej Kłopotowski ..:: thread{at}o2{dot}pl
Brzezi - 20-11-2006 01:02
sob, 02 wrz 2006 o 15:29 GMT, Thread napisał(a):
>> sa inne formatery > No właśnie, tylko chodzi o to aby wstrzelić się w ten właściwy;)
http://java.sun.com/j2se/1.5.0/docs/...Formatter.html
Pozdrawiam Brzezi -- [ E-mail: brzezi@enter.net.pl ][ brzezi:~# uptime ] [ Ekg: #3781111 ][ 15:49:20 up 1 day, 18:40, 1 user, ] [ LinuxUser: #249916 ][ load average: 0.68, 0.46, 0.33 ]
Thread - 20-11-2006 01:02
Brzezi wrote:
> sob, 02 wrz 2006 o 15:29 GMT, Thread napisał(a): > > http://java.sun.com/j2se/1.5.0/docs/...Formatter.html
Wiedziałem, że to nie trudne, tylko, trzeba było wiedzieć gdzie szukać! Dla potomnych... przykład: String.format( "%1$8s %2$9s", "nap1", nap2" ); "nap1" zostanie wyświetlnony na 8 miejscach "nap2" zostanie wyświetlnony na 9 miejscach Dzięki, za pomoc.
Pozdrawiam, Thread -- ..:: Thread ..:: Andrzej Kłopotowski ..:: thread{at}o2{dot}pl
zanotowane.pldoc.pisz.plpdf.pisz.pleffulla.pev.pl
|
Jak =?ISO-8859-2?Q?zamieni=E6_dwa_pola_jednej_kolumny_?==?ISO-8859-2?Q?w_dw=F3ch_rekordach_za_pomoc=B1_jednego_zapyt? ==?ISO-8859-2?Q?ania=3F?=
[mysql] =?ISO-8859-2?Q?po=B3=B1czenie_tabel_wg_kolumn=2C_?==?ISO-8859-2?Q?nie_wierszy?=
[ORACLE] Dodanie kolumny typu BLOB - =?ISO-8859-2?Q?wp=B3yw_na?==?ISO-8859-2?Q?_wydajno=B6c?=
=?ISO-8859-2?Q?=5BORACLE=2C_ORDER_BY=5D_Czy_indeksowane_?==?I SO-8859-2?Q?kolumny_przy=B6piesz=B1_sortowanie=3F?=
pytanie o zapytanie z having count = count z innej kolumny
[MySQL/PHP] Wyszukiwanie rekordu przez kolumnę wskazaną przez zmienną
=?iso-8859-2?q?Pytanie_SQL__spe=B3niaj=B1ce_wiecej_jak_jeden_ warunek_na_jednej_kolumnie=2E?=
=?iso-8859-2?Q?=5BMSSQL2005=5D_Zawarto=B6c_kolumny_varbinary= 28max=29_?=
SELECT MAX(nazwaPola) FROM tabela WHERE .... i ORA-01405: pobran? warto?ci? kolumny jest NULL
=?iso-8859-2?Q?=5BORACLE=5D_-_projekcja_kolumn_okre=B6lonego_typu?=
zanotowane.pldoc.pisz.plpdf.pisz.plabsolwenci.keep.pl
Cytat
Decede mihi sole - nie zasłaniaj mi słonca. Gdy kogoś kochasz, jesteś jak stworzyciel świata - na cokolwiek spojrzysz, nabiera to kształtu, wypełnia się barwą, światłem. Powietrze przytula się do ciebie, choćby był mróz, a ty masz w sobie tyle radości, że musisz ją rozdawać wokoło, bo się w tobie nie mieści Hoc fac - tak czyń. A tergo - od tyłu; z tyłu. I czarne włosy posiwieją. Safona |
|